你查询的IP:[123.206.107.255]  地理位置:中国–上海–上海

最新查询58.128.127.154 123.165.128.61 125.104.8.201 116.13.214.228 120.129.196.96 125.171.181.132 116.13.138.175 119.159.200.221 60.136.166.221 123.206.107.255 210.72.158.164 119.39.218.39 123.244.147.216 116.254.128.169 210.185.192.185 120.24.112.154 210.28.206.36 202.122.32.153 116.66.132.136 122.136.14.71 203.130.32.58 121.46.63.247 123.232.33.28 118.228.182.174 192.188.170.127 202.14.238.53 124.240.128.118 123.184.98.89 210.51.119.191 119.162.142.191 202.22.248.105